In the end, Becky touched endless numbers of people but never had the honeymoon she and her new husband deserved. That's where Dave came in and presented them with five days and four nights at the Fairmont Sonoma Mission Inn and Spa, in the heart of Sonoma's wine country. They'll enjoy a 40,000 square-foot spa, a golf course, top-notch dining, and wine-tasting, coastal sightseeing and racing school for the hubby.

Becky responded with a moment of pure disbelief, followed by tears of joy and unending thankfulness. As the "Saturday Night Live" character Linda Richman would say, "I got a little verklempt." What can I say, I'm a softy.
